Hi Sally Welcome to the mad house. Don't worry we're only mad on family trees but we don't bite. The homepage has links to loads of info that would be good to read. If you go to the bottem there is a section called Genealogy resources. Work through each section and it will explain what information you can get from different things. For maiden names you would need marriage certificates or from 1911/1912 the index pages (which give you a reference to order the certificates) give the spouces surname and for births it gives the mothers maiden name.
